Roxx Revolt & The Velvets releases new EP ‘Uno’

Roxx Revolt & The Velvets, a Miami-based rock n’ roll band have released a new EP called ‘Uno’ featuring three new singles and two music videos. Experience the nostalgic sounds of classic rock with a modern twist!

The opening track on ‘Uno’ EP, ‘Run For Cover’ is a hard-hitting piece with ripping guitars, a driving bass line, and a forceful drum beat that makes the walls shake, and, of course, let’s not forget the distinctive and powerful vocals. This track comes with a cinematic music video showing the band playing a concert at a venue which becomes vampire-infested. It’s a top-shelf production with video directed by Mijo. The band appears to have a wonderful future in front of them. With notable appearances at the Gasparilla Music Festival, Black Market Fest Miami, and even opening for the iconic rock band Puddle of Mudd, they’ve grown fast since the release of their debut EP ‘7’ in 2021.

The second single, ‘Get High’, which has garnered over 100K Spotify streams, comes with a nostalgic 70s atmosphere and encourages listeners to live life on their terms and embracing all the things that make our lives beautiful. Enjoy the fun music video which follows their recent tour of the United States East Coast.

The new EP ‘Uno’ with 3 tracks is enough to show how masterful these artists really are behind the instruments. Roxx Revolt & The Velvets consists of members Roxx Revolt on vocals/guitar, Dan Heath playing bass, Jake Shockley on guitar, and the drummer Chris Campo. They are a perfect team, and we will undoubtedly hear more about them. Because of the way they charge forward, it makes them a rock band you don’t want to miss seeing live.
